“unpack requires a buffer of 8 bytes”错误信息解析 1. 错误信息含义 “unpack requires a buffer of 8 bytes”这个错误信息表明,在尝试使用unpack函数(通常用于解包二进制数据)时,提供的缓冲区(buffer)大小不足8字节。unpack函数期望能够从这个缓冲区中读取8字节的数据,但实际上得到的缓冲区大小小于这个要求。
Connection( File "/home/airflow/.local/lib/python3.10/site-packages/redshift_connector/core.py", line 707, in __init__ code, data_len = ci_unpack(self._read(5)) struct.error: unpack_from requires a buffer of at least 5 bytes for unpacking 5 bytes at offset 0 (actual buffer size ...
stable-diffusion-tensorflow/venv/lib/python3.8/site-packages/flatbuffers/encode.py", line 26, in Get return packer_type.unpack_from(memoryview_type(buf), head)[0] struct.error: unpack_from requires a buffer of at least 4 bytes for unpacking 4 bytes at offset 0 (actual buffer size is 0)...
django执行迁移文件报错struct.error: unpack requires a buffer of 4 bytes,问题:我使用的版本说明django:2.2版本djangorestframework:3.11版本python3.6版本解决查了下资料,没有很详细的说明,我是因为需要使用继承django自带的User模型并自定义一个模型类,需要配置AU
with open('Test.bmp', 'rb') as f: s = f.read(30) #利用struct提取信息 struct.unpack('<ccIIIIIHH',s) #报错 #struct.error: unpack requires a buffer of 26 bytes 原因是,unpack函数的第一个参数中少写了一个I(4字节),导致处理的数据大小为26Bytes,而s为30Bytes。 修改为: struct.unpack(...
django执行迁移文件报错struct.error: unpack requires a buffer of 4 bytes 问题: 我使用的版本说明 django:2.2版本 djangorestframework:3.11版本 python3.6版本 解决 查了下资料,没有很详细的说明,我是因为需要使用继承django自带的User模型并自定义一个模型类,需要配置AUTH_USER_MODEL,但是我不是第一数据库迁移的时...
struct.err..struct.error: unpack requires a buffer of 16 bytes,用pyinstall打包exe的时候,出现这个,dist文件夹里面也没有exe文件,该怎么办upup
pandas读入xls文件出现:"unpack requires a buffer of 2 bytes" 将对应的xls文件打开后发现,另存为是灰色。这时的操作的是: 点击保存-->弹出启用保存,然后点击确认,然后再点保存,即可通过pd.read_excel打开。 网上还有种说法是另存为xlsx文件,发现通过批量修改会损坏上述文件。所以需要慎重。
数据是数据科学中任何分析的关键,大多数分析中最常用的数据集类型是存储在逗号分隔值(csv)表中的干净...
When connecting using mycli I see the following on the console. $ mycli Connecting to socket /var/run/mysqld/mysqlx.sock, owned by user mysql unpack requires a buffer of 4 bytes $ Running with DEBUG, this is in the log. 2024-01-17 12:16:...